Sermon: Don’t Look Back

“Don’t Look Back”

(June 27, 2010) We are very accustomed to praising Jesus for calling his disciples away from sin or labor and into a life of servant-hood, but what about those times when Jesus calls people away from good things like home and family and honor and tradition? Are we ready to respond when the call of God draws us away from the things of the past, the safety of family and comfort zones, the traditions and honor of the past, and into a future that promises only a journey and “no place to lay our heads”? We can only pray for the courage to respond faithfully. (Luke 9:51-62)
